The 2001 Ford Taurus FFV is a large sedan with a 3.0L engine and a 4-speed automatic transmission, running on regular gasoline. As a flexible-fuel vehicle (FFV), it offers the option to use ethanol-based fuels, providing flexibility at the pump. Its spacious interior and straightforward design make it a practical choice for everyday driving.

What does FFV stand for in Ford Taurus FFV?
FFV stands for Flexible Fuel Vehicle, meaning the car can run on either regular gasoline or E85 ethanol blend, giving drivers more fuel options.
Is the Ford Taurus FFV fuel-efficient?
The Ford Taurus FFV has moderate fuel efficiency for its class, averaging around 18-20 mpg in the city and 26-28 mpg on the highway, depending on driving conditions and fuel type used.
